From Ercuis to Cergy by bus and train
To get from Ercuis to Cergy in Paris,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one train line: take the L1 bus from Maison du Village station to Gare - Parking Rue Hadancourt station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the H train and finally take the 1201 bus from Pontoise Gare station to Chemin Dupuis station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 2 hr 9 min.
